I don't think the purpose of ads especially the ones like we're seeing on this website right now, or the ones in front of YT videos for example, are particularly meant to make the consumer say "oh wow, I'd really like this product". It's more of a subconscious thing where these products are being planted in the back of our mind. For example when most people see Panera Bread ad's right in front of a YT video they're probably not going to stop what they're doing and order Panera Bread. BUT, the next time they're out shopping and they're hungry and they see a Panera Bread, subconsciously that ad they saw on YT a couple days ago is going to trigger something and make them think "hmm, that sounds good".
